Patrick Schulte (born March 13, 2001) is an American professional soccer player who plays as a goalkeeper for Columbus Crew in Major League Soccer.

Schulte attended Francis Howell High School, where he was a three-time All-Academic selection. Schulte was also a three-year varsity starter on the basketball team and helped the Vikings to a fourth-place finish in the Missouri Class 5A state championship.[1][2] Schulte played with the Saint Louis FC academy, helping the team advance to the USSDA playoffs in 2019 and later signing a USL academy contract with the team. During his time, Schulte also had a training stint with Dutch side Feyenoord.[3][4] He appeared for Saint Louis FC on May 15, 2019, starting in a Lamar Hunt U.S. Open Cup fixture against Des Moines Menace, helping the team progress in a penalty shootout win.[5][6][7]
In 2019, Schulte committed to playing college soccer at Saint Louis University.[8] In three seasons with the Billikens, Schulte went on to make 51 appearances. In his freshman year, he earned an Atlantic 10 Conference All-Rookie team selection. His sophomore year saw Schulte take Atlantic 10 Conference Defensive Player of the Year and be named A-10 first-team All-Conference. In 2021, he was again named A-10 first-team All-Conference, as well as United Soccer Coaches second-team All-Region, and Most Outstanding Player of the A-10 Championship.[1]
While at college, Schulte also played in the USL League Two, making nine regular season appearances for St. Louis Scott Gallagher during the 2021 season.[9][10]
On January 6, 2022, it was announced that Schulte would leave college early and sign a Generation Adidas contract with Major League Soccer, allowing him to enter the 2022 MLS SuperDraft.[11][12]
On January 11, 2022, Schulte was selected 12th overall by Columbus Crew in the MLS SuperDraft.[13][14][15]
In 2022, Schulte spent time with the Crew's MLS Next Pro side Columbus Crew 2.[16]
Schulte was called up to the United States national under-20 team in both 2019 and 2020.[17][5]
